NC finally lands Apple campus, bringing $1 billion and 3,000 jobs to Wake County 04/26/2021

Fantastic news for and !
Thousands of new jobs coming to the Triangle. This project was years in the making - with much of the heavy lifting done by Chris Dillon of Wake County Government and the exceptional teams of Economic Development and Raleigh Chamber. Congratulations to all!

NC finally lands Apple campus, bringing $1 billion and 3,000 jobs to Wake County The new campus will be in the Wake County portion of Research Triangle Park campus.

After a thorough nationwide search, Wake County has hired Nannette M. Bowler to lead its Human Services Department. She will serve as director for the county’s largest department, which oversees public health and social services for the community.

In her new role, which begins Monday, Jan. 18, 2021, Bowler will lead the Human Services Department to build collaboration, consistent policy and service delivery. The department is dedicated to providing public health, social services and transportation services to more than 200,000 people a year.

Wake County needs your input on our draft comprehensive plan, which will guide growth for the decades to come.

“This is about the future of Wake County,” said Greg Ford, chairman of the Wake County Board of Commissioners. “Public input is critical to the success of a comprehensive plan, and this is your opportunity provide feedback about the direction it takes.”

For the past two years, Wake County planners dug into data, listened to community comments, and engaged stakeholders and partners to shape a comprehensive plan to guide future growth. Now, the draft plan — known as — is ready for your review. http://ow.ly/Alhp50Cqr7T
